Calories: 343 per servingCategory: Appetizer1. Grate all of the cheeses. In a medium bowl, combine the cheeses with the cornstarch, tossing thoroughly to coat all pieces.
2. In a stove-safe fondue pot or large heavy saucepan, bring the wine, garlic, and lemon juice to a simmer over medium-low heat. Add the cheeses to the simmering liquid a little at a time, stirring well between each addition to ensure a smooth fondue. Once smooth, stir in the brandy, mustard, and nutmeg.
3. Arrange an assortment of bite-size dipping foods on a platter. If necessary, carefully pour the fondue into a fondue pot. Serve with fondue forks or wooden skewers. Dip and enjoy!

Total Time: 35 minsCategory: DinnerCalories: 492 per serving1. In a fondue pot, add your garlic clove and white wine. Put on medium heat until the wine is simmering.
2. Slowly add a bit of the cheeses into the wine while mixing with a silicone spatula. Make sure you only add a bit at a time and only add more cheese once the previous cheese has melted.
3. Once all of the cheese has been added, you'll notice that the cheese and alcohol won't mix together. Add 1 tsp of xanthan gum and always continue whisking. The cheese fondue should slowly start to thicken and the alcohol and cheese will slowly mix together. If it still hasn't mixed together, just add 1/4 tsp of xanthan gum more at a time until it does. Personally I used 1.5 tsp and it was the perfect consistency.
4. Once the fondue is all mixed together, turn the heat to low and start dipping your ingredients inside the yummy cheese!

How do you make cheese fondue?

How to make cheese fondue: Melt the butter over low heat and then add the cornstarch, stirring until well combined – you can use a fondue pot or a saucepan on the stove – either method works great! Mix the salt in well and then add the milk. Turn the heat down slightly and then add the cheese.

Can you make cheese fondue without wine?

If you’d like to make this cheese fondue recipe without wine, you can substitute 8 oz. of unsalted chicken or vegetable stock. This is SO important to make sure the cheese fondue you make at home is buttery smooth and tastes even better than a cheese fondue restaurant.
